sheet metal enclosures are an essential component in the manufacturing industry, providing a durable and reliable solution for housing various electronic components and equipment. These enclosures are commonly used in a wide range of applications, including industrial machinery, control panels, and electrical cabinets. The versatility and benefits of sheet metal enclosures make them a popular choice for manufacturers looking for a cost-effective and efficient solution to protect sensitive equipment.
One of the main advantages of sheet metal enclosures is their durability. Made from high-quality materials such as steel, aluminum, or stainless steel, these enclosures are designed to withstand harsh environmental conditions, including extreme temperatures, humidity, and vibration. This durability ensures that the enclosed equipment remains safe and secure, reducing the risk of damage or malfunction.
In addition to their durability, sheet metal enclosures are also highly customizable. Manufacturers can design enclosures in various shapes and sizes to accommodate different types of equipment and components. This flexibility allows for efficient use of space and ensures that the enclosure fits the specific requirements of the application. Customization options also include the addition of features such as mounting brackets, ventilation holes, doors, and windows, further enhancing the functionality of the enclosure.
Another benefit of sheet metal enclosures is their excellent electromagnetic shielding properties. The metal construction of the enclosure provides a barrier that blocks electromagnetic interference (EMI) from external sources, such as radio signals or electrical noise. This shielding is essential for protecting sensitive electronic equipment from interference that could affect its performance or reliability. By using a sheet metal enclosure, manufacturers can ensure that their equipment operates smoothly and without disruptions.
sheet metal enclosures also offer superior thermal management capabilities. The metal construction provides excellent heat dissipation, helping to regulate the temperature inside the enclosure and prevent overheating of the enclosed equipment. Proper thermal management is crucial for maintaining the performance and longevity of electronic components, making sheet metal enclosures an ideal choice for applications where temperature control is essential.
Additionally, sheet metal enclosures are cost-effective and efficient to manufacture. The materials used in their construction are readily available and affordable, making them a budget-friendly option for manufacturers. The durability and longevity of sheet metal enclosures also contribute to their cost-effectiveness, as they require minimal maintenance and have a long service life. Furthermore, the ease of customization and quick production times make sheet metal enclosures a practical choice for manufacturers looking to streamline their production process.
